Jean PavillardJean Pavillard (Switzerland)

Jean Pavillard has been a professional mountain guide for twenty-two years. Born and raised in Switzerland, Jean developed his mountaineering skills through the tradition of Swiss mountain guiding by apprenticing and attending national courses. Jean has been the technical director for the American Mountain Guide Association and was instrumental in helping the AMGA become a part of the international association. He is certified by the Swiss and American associations and is a member of the International Association of Mountain Guides. He has guided all over the world teaching courses on all aspects of mountaineering for several national organizations. He has worked as an examiner during the national testing for the American and British mountain guide associations. By soliciting the best minds in the business, Jean has designed and developed, a curriculum for Adventures to the Edge’s Guides Training Center and a 3 level (introductory level through professional) avalanche course of study. Jean has been featured in a number of industry publications: Couloir, Ski, Sports Illustrated. These articles clearly define Jean as a leader in the industry dedicated to the development of education for safe mountain travel.

Andrew LockAndrew Lock (Australia)

KL Adventure & Aconcagua Express are proud for founding Andrew as one of their Lead Guides. Andrew is part of the great mountaineering history, with almost all 14th eight thousands meter peaks, currently trying Kanchenzunga and Anapurna in one season push, Andrew has successfully guide since 1992 extensively in Mt Lobuche Nepal, Baltoro glacier trek and crossing of high altitude pass, Gondogoro La, Karakorum mts in Pakistan, Central Asia exploratory trek and mountain traverse in Pamir and Tien Shan ranges in Kazakstan and Tadjikistan, Leader of successful commercial expedition to Mt Everest 7 clients, leader trekking groups in Peru, to Ausangante and Huayhuash mountain ranges, leader, mountaineering team to Cordillera Real and Cordillera Blanca mountain ranges in Peru and Bolivia. His climbing achievement counts on: 1987 Mt McKinley, Alaska, first Australian ascent of the West Rib. 1988 Pumori, Australian expedition, Nepal Himalaya. 1989 Pik Korchenevskaja, Pamir Ranges, first Australian ascent. 1990 Polish glacier Aconcagua, Argentina, ascent and solo traverse of mountain. 1993 K2 1st Australian ascent from the Pakistan side, 2nd highest peak in the world. 1997 Dhaulagiri, Nepal 1st Australian ascent 7th highest peak in the world. 1997 Broad Peak, solo ascent 12th highest peak in the world. 1998 Nanga Parbat 1st Australian ascent 9th highest in the world peak. 1999 Hidden Peak 1st Australian ascent 11th highest peak in the world. 1999 Gasherbrum 2 Alpine style ascent 13th highest peak in the world. 2002 Manaslu leader and 1st Australian ascent 8th highest peak in the world. 2002 Lhotse solo ascent. 4th highest peak in the world. These last two peak was done in same a single climbing pre monsoon season!!
